Strategic Consultant
“Every successful business or organization must have a clear vision of what they want to achieve, and a long term plan to implement that vision. But at the same time, they should be flexible enough to take advantage of unexpected opportunities.”
Peter Hannam is recognized in many circles, but is undoubtedly most prominent in agricultural circles as a leader, visionary, facilitator of partnerships, and of course, a farmer. As an early integrator of research and technology, Peter utilized Woodrill, his farm near Guelph, Ontario to research both machinery and seed technology. He would go on to be a co-founder of the value-added business First Line Seeds, which he successfully managed for twenty years. Many of Peter's past accomplishments have involved aligning complementary businesses for the benefit of Canadian agriculture. These alignments included First Line Seeds with Asgrow Seed Company, the leading soybean breeder, developer, and distributor in the United States. Peter’s vision with First Line Seeds would then culminate in the sale of the company to Monsanto.
With more than forty years of involvement and experience in agriculture, Peter believes that policy development through commodity organizations is important for the foundation of all agriculture business. As the leading force behind the development of the Ontario AgriCentre, he has provided the opportunity for many agricultural organizations to share resources and expertise. Peter has also had first-hand involvement in many organizations, such as serving as President of the Ontario Federation of Agriculture and the Chair of the Canadian Soybean Export Association.

James is a management consultant with 30 years of experience working in the Ontario food and beverage processing industry in both the private and public sectors. His consulting practice - Jayeff Partners - is dedicated to providing strategic business solutions. He works with many agri-food organizations and food processors on collaborative projects that contribute to a stronger agri-food sector in Ontario, and has teamed up with Synthesis (the lead contractor) to work together to deliver an initiative of the Alliance of Ontario Food Processors.
A Certified General Accountant and former CFO of an entrepreneurial, family-owned food processing business, he has experienced first-hand the excitement and challenges of business growth and technological innovation. James supported the company’s 20-fold growth over a ten-year period and its expansion from a regional to national player.
For five years, he progressed through senior positions with the Food Industry Competitiveness Branch of the Ontario Ministry of Agriculture, Food and Rural Affairs. As Manager of the Client Account Unit, James set up a comprehensive corporate call program through which government identified and supported the needs of Ontario firms to attract investment and export product mandates. As Director of the Branch, James contributed to a strategic review with industry partners of government’s priorities for the food industry, reorganizing the branch to enhance investment, job retention and export development.
James maintains an extensive network of contacts throughout Ontario’s agri-food sector that provide him with management insights and fresh business strategy perspectives. He is committed to and passionate about seeing Ontario farmers and food processors thrive in the global economy.
